2. Baby-proof your home

Babies are curious creatures, and they'll get into everything! Start baby-proofing your home now so you can relax once the baby arrives. Think outlet covers, cabinet locks, and corner guards. Safety first, folks!

You'll also need to think about specific rooms in the home. Are there any hazards lurking in your kitchen or bathroom? Put safety latches on all potential danger zones and make sure you keep hazardous chemicals stored away from little hands. Keep an eye out for small items that could be choking hazards too. Take a look at the furniture, too. Is it sturdy enough for the little one's climbing attempts? Will you need to get anchors or wall brackets for dressers and bookcases? Finally, don't forget to address any potential hazards in your home, like unsecured rugs or exposed wiring. 5. Snag a sweet ride (for the baby)

No, we're not talking about a sports car. You'll need a safe and reliable car seat and stroller for your little one. Do your research and find the best options that fit your lifestyle and budget. Safety first, remember?

When buying a car seat, make sure it meets the latest safety standards. Also, check to see if there are any recalls or repair kits available for your chosen model. You'll also need to figure out what type of stroller will work best for you - jogging strollers are great for active parents, while travel systems offer maximum convenience. Shop around and read reviews to find the perfect ride for your baby!

7. Pack your hospital bag

When the big day arrives, you don't want to be scrambling to pack your bag. Make a list of essentials like comfy clothes, toiletries, and snacks (you'll be hungry, trust us). Don't forget the baby's going-home outfit and a cozy blanket.

Other must-haves include your insurance information, birthing plan, and a notepad and pen. Pack an overnight bag for your partner too - they'll thank you later!
